What's it about?
Artificial Intelligence (AI) is transforming the way we live, learn and work, and Generative AI (GenAI) - the generative branch of AI - is at the forefront of that change. While headlines often focus on fears of job losses or hype about new opportunities, the reality is more complex. Our research, including recent studies at Hertfordshire Business School, explores how AI is reshaping the labour market: which roles might evolve, which could disappear, and which new ones could emerge. The Fantasy Job Finder stand turns this research into an accessible, hands-on experience.
The aim isn’t just to entertain – it’s to encourage curiosity, prompt questions, and spark conversations about how technology might influence the jobs we and our children do in years to come. We’ll also be on hand to share insights from our work on AI’s potential benefits and challenges, from increased efficiency to the need for ethical safeguards. By taking part, you’re helping us gather perspectives from people of all ages and backgrounds – voices that are essential for shaping a future of work that is fair, inclusive, and informed by the community it serves.
